When the Olympic games start on Friday, you’ll have new sports to check out.
Tokyo Olympics are debuting four new ones. Surfing will be featured with 40 athletes hitting the waves. The top surfers are coming from the U.S. and Australia, but experts also say don't count out Brazil and host country Japan.
Skateboarding also features several top Americans expected to compete in the medal rounds. Southern California's Nyjah Huston [[ nai-juh hyoo-stn ]] is the top skater in the world and the favorite to win gold.
Other new sports include Karate and Sport Climbing. Baseball and softball are also sports to watch this time around and span the whole time period of the games.
The idea was to get younger people to check out the Olympics.
